Abstract: Provided is a system and method for evaluating laser treatment, for converting the attribute of a laser beam and numerically evaluating proficiency of a laser treatment operator by processing data obtained by photographing the converted laser beam so as to use the evaluated data as training data. The laser treatment evaluating system includes an attenuation unit for attenuating intensity of a laser beam transmitted through a transmissive plate, a camera for photographing the laser beam transmitted through the attenuation unit, and an image data processing apparatus connected to the camera, for processing an image captured by the camera, tracking a trajectory of a laser beam on the transmissive plate, and calculating a distribution state of spots on which the laser beam on the transmissive plate is emitted.

Abstract: A headset of a surgical robot system includes an endoscope image transmission module configured to transmit an endoscope image to a main screen, a surgical assist function transmission module configured to transmit a selected and activated surgical assist function on an auxiliary screen positioned at one side of the main screen, a surgical assist function optional transmission module configured to transmit a list of a plurality of surgical assist functions to be provided on the auxiliary screen to a selection screen, an acceleration sensor and a gyroscope, configured to detect a change in a position of a head of a user, an eye tracking module configured to detect a change in a user gaze and a change in focus, and a controller configured to control a specific surgical assist function selected from among the plurality of surgical assist functions to be provided to the auxiliary screen.

Abstract: The present disclosure relates to a method and device for generating clinical record data for recording medical treatment. The method includes receiving medical data in which medical treatment, performed in advance, is recorded; recording information, included in the medical data, in a layer corresponding to an item related to the medical data from among a plurality of layers classified according to a plurality of items; and generating a clinical report based on the plurality of layers.
